I had a 2001 GT that I had to replace a tail light on and now I have a 2001 Cobra. I think the amber area is filled with an extra bulb. You can take yours off and compare with the back picture of this one. http://www.americanmuscle.com/taillights-9904-smoked.html

It looks like there is a unused circle where the amber is on the stock cobra lights. You might be able to modify it, but of course that is a lot of money to spend on a maybe. Also if it gets messed up then that's really suck. Your other option is to modify the wiring and light sockets to a V6/GT. Have to be careful to get the right wires connected up. If you go this route you have to make sure the spliced wires are sealed well. Solder and a soldering iron will probably make the best connection with some heat shrink over them and then seal the edges of the heat shrink with glue.

Generally we are just out of luck when it comes to replacing tail lights.

The wiring harnesses are different between GTs and 99-01 Cobras. You can cut up your harnesses and make GT's work but I wouldn't suggest it. I bought an extra set of tail lights a year ago because I knew they were never going to get any cheaper.
